Most nests are constructed in the breeding year through the male swiftlet more than a duration of 35 days. They take the shape of the shallow cup stuck for the cave wall. The nests are made up of interwoven strands of salivary cement. Both of those nests have higher amounts of calcium, iron, potassium, and magnesium.[two]

These swifts by no means settle voluntarily on the bottom.[ten] The nest is white and translucent and it is manufactured from layers of hardened saliva hooked up for the rock.
According to the Qing dynasty guide of gastronomy, the Suiyuan shidan, fowl's nest was viewed as a fragile component never to be flavored or cooked with just about anything overpowering or oily. Though it can be unusual and high priced, it have to be served in fairly substantial quantities; if not its texture cannot be fully experienced and savored.[5]

They breed in colonies in coastal locations, in limestone caves, in rock crevices, in the cleft in a very cliff or in some cases over a building.[eleven] The bracket-formed nest is built with a vertical area and also the prolonged legs are used for clinging.
